Full body suits: cover the entire torso and limbs, providing comprehensive haptic feedback. upper body suits: focus on the torso and upper limbs, offering haptic sensations for a wider range of actions. hand based suits: target the hands and fingers, primarily for interactive experiences. By varying amplitude, frequency, and amperage, delivered via a fine web of electrodes arrayed over the body, a suit like this can give the wearer a long list of different sensations, called "haptic animations". With the new funding, haptx, in collaboration with the two partner research institutions, now aims to develop full body immersion where digital sensations can be convincingly replicated in real life. the team will leverage haptx’s microfluidic technology for use with a robotic exoskeleton. A full body vr suit is an advanced wearable that tracks your movements and simulates physical sensations like touch, pressure, and temperature in virtual environments. it is powered by sensors, actuators, and haptic feedback systems, bridging your body and the digital realm.
